Ingredients:
6 1/2 cups rice cereal
10oz bag of mini marshmallows (divided)
4-5 Tbs butter or margarine
2/3 cup candy corn
Directions:

On medium low heat, melt butter and marshmallows (reserve 1 cup mini marshmallows). Once fully melted add the rice krispies and mix well. Then add the remaining cup of mini marshmallows and mix together with the rice krispies. Pour mixture into a buttered baking dish and press down. Top with candy corn and press down again. Allow rice krispies to set for 2 hours. Cut into squares and serve. Enjoy.
Tip: I used wax paper over the mixture so I could press down the with my hands.
